Interstitial ads are a frequently used type of online advertising that appear in between content on a website or app. These full-screen ads often appear when users switch to a new page or complete a task. While some users may find them disruptive, interstitial ads can be effective for driving revenue and enhancing brand awareness. To maximize their impact, it's essential to understand the different types of interstitial ads and follow best practices for implementation.

Interstitial Ads Explained: A Comprehensive Guide
Interstitial ads are a common kind of online advertising that appear in between pages of websites or apps. They typically take up the entire screen and display a message before users can continue to the next part of their experience. These ads are often full-screen and designed to be noticeable.
